The core competency of Teams and Teamwork emphasizes the importance of collaboration among healthcare professionals to improve patient outcomes and enhance team functionality. Utilizing shared leadership practices is crucial because it encourages input from all team members, promotes a sense of ownership over the team's goals, and fosters an environment of mutual respect and communication. This collaborative approach not only enhances team effectiveness but also ensures that diverse perspectives are incorporated, ultimately leading to more comprehensive and holistic care for patients.
